
This is down to its almost black, lightly waved leaves with their deep pink markings that give the impression of subtle neon lighting. Not only that, but the petioles are a deep reddish brown. All of this makes ‘Dottie’ an exquisite houseplant. Tests at the FloraHolland auction also showed that the plant has an excellent life span. The elliptical, almost rubbery leaves can achieve diameters of 20 to 25 cm and have a “sleep position” like all the other Calatheas. They reach heights of 60 to 70 cm when planted in 19 cm pots.
Calathea roseo-picta ‘Dottie’ (vbn code 100405) has been on sale since May 2007 and is available all year round.
